Output 253a95558af90fe2f0a1dfd52cf7eccb3deccf925cf1ef27bc2dc077260a0aed:0

value
63875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 256b3bca92648b96a3783aceff213ba4d5402b56 OP_EQUAL
address
356sPMpiwroMWZLTtSTTRmnE7aRmSJnJbq
transaction
253a95558af90fe2f0a1dfd52cf7eccb3deccf925cf1ef27bc2dc077260a0aed
confirmations
158973
spent
true